Drone Hits Fuel Tank Near Dubai International Airport, Flights Temporarily Suspended

Share

Flights at Dubai International Airport (DXB) were temporarily suspended early Monday March 16,2026, after a drone struck a fuel tank near the airport, triggering a fire that authorities quickly contained.

Officials said emergency teams responded rapidly and brought the blaze under control, with no injuries reported.

The suspension of flight operations was implemented as a precaution to ensure the safety of passengers and airport staff.

According to the Dubai Media Office, the incident occurred in the vicinity of the airport and affected one of the fuel storage tanks.

Emirates Suspends Flights and Issues Advisory

Following the incident, Emirates airline announced the temporary suspension of all flights to and from Dubai and advised travelers not to go to the airport until further notice.

In a statement shared by Emirates Support, the airline said:

“All flights to and from Dubai have been temporarily suspended. Please do not go to the airport.”

The airline added:

“The safety of our passengers and crew is our highest priority and will not be compromised.”

Passengers were advised to contact their airlines or check official channels for the latest updates regarding flight schedules.

Flights Diverted as Airport Operations Halt

Authorities confirmed that the suspension was a precautionary safety measure while emergency teams handled the incident.

Some incoming flights were diverted to Al Maktoum International Airport as operations at Dubai’s main airport were halted.

Dubai Civil Defence teams managed to prevent the fire from spreading further, ensuring the situation remained under control.

Incident Linked to Rising Regional Tensions

The drone strike occurred amid escalating tensions in the Middle East linked to the ongoing conflict involving Iran, the United States and Israel.

While some reports and social media posts have suggested possible Iranian involvement, no group has officially claimed responsibility for the attack as investigations continue.

The incident marks another disruption to regional aviation, with airspace closures and security threats affecting travel routes across the Gulf in recent weeks.

Authorities Urge Travelers to Await Updates

Dubai authorities and airlines have urged travelers to stay updated through official announcements as airport operations remain temporarily suspended.

Travelers were advised to avoid the airport and monitor airline communications for further information regarding flight resumption.
